This Designer Is Crocheting Sneakers Into Cozy Slippers For a Great Cause

Image
The Kicks : Fuggit Why We Love Them: You guys, crochet sneakers are a thing, and they're cool as heck. Fuggit is a brand that takes sneakers and turns them into slippers for a great cause. The designer behind the brand, Rich Riley, creates one-of-a-kind handmade sneaker-slippers that are based on some of the most sought-after sneakers in the market right now. Think everything from Yeezy Boost 700 Wave Runners to Sean Wotherspoon's rainbow Nikes . The Instagram account has become a hotspot for sneakerheads looking for something that's unique and comfortable. Fuggit's shoes really give a whole new meaning to the word "comfy," because each of the shoes is lined inside with a layer of Sherpa - talk about cozy. Another amazing thing? Sephora Will Now Reopen 70 Stores This Week With New Safety Guidelines in Place

Image
Update: On May 22, Sephora began reopening 70 of its stores across 30 states where local governments deemed it safe to do so, but that initial reopening plan has been modified again in light of recent events. "We are deeply saddened by the recent loss of George Floyd and the pain experienced by African Americans and communities of color across America," a rep for Sephora told POPSUGAR in an email. "We are moving forward with our phased reopening plan, but we have had to make some changes, and we will only reopen locations when it is safe to do so, and the store is ready. There are some stores that were not yet scheduled to reopen, and they will remain closed, as we monitor this evolving situation." The rep explained that all employees staffed at these closed stores will be paid and receive their benefits as planned. Sephora will also be providing workers with counseling and support resources. Kenzo Just Gave Your Vans a Tropical Makeover For the Summer

Image
If, in the coming weeks, you start to see these floral Vans pop up on your Instagram feed, here's why: Kenzo has collaborated with the skate brand on a full capsule collection, which includes 46 ready-to-wear pieces, including bucket hats, hoodies, sweats, and tees, along with a limited-edition art skateboard deck, for which 100 percent of profits go to Jamaica's Freedom Skatepark , a project that empowers at-risk youth. Of course, we're largely focused on the sneakers here, and they will be, without a doubt, the most prized possessions from this line, which marks Kenzo Creative Director Felipe Oliveira Baptista's first collaboration for the fashion house. Vans and Kenzo have transformed the classic Old-Skool sneaker and Sk8-Hi with a vibrant tropical-inspired print, and it's the same look that extends to the rest of the streetwear in the range. Lizzo Works Up a Sweat in Sports Bra and Leggings With Functional Gym Shoes

Image
Lizzo let fans have a glimpse into her fitness regimen yesterday. Taking to TikTok, the “Good as Hell” singer shared a video of herself going through the motions of an intense workout routine, including jumping rope, pedaling an exercise bike and doing squat jumps. Throughout the video, Lizzo changed outfits numerous times. The “Cuz I Love You” songstress matched Adidas leggings with neon accents to a neon green crop as well as a cropped workout shirt. She also chose a monochromatic look with a black tank top and matching Reebok leggings. Additionally, Lizzo was seen riding her bike while clad in a bluish-gray Nike outfit. Lucy Hale Gives Mom Jeans a Comfy-Chic Spin With a Graphic Tee & Converse Kicks

Image
Lucy Hale showed off comfy-chic style yesterday in Los Angeles. The “Katy Keene” actress hit the city streets clad in a graphic T-shirt from All Good Feels, which read “Kind people are my kinda people.” The tee sells for $42 on the brand’s site. Hale paired her T-shirt with medium-wash mom jeans that featured darker accents at the cuffs. Lucy Hale goes for a stroll in Los Angeles wearing an All Good Feels “Kind People” T-shirt, mom jeans and Converse Chuck Taylor All-Star sneakers, June 9. CREDIT: Rex/Shutterstock A closer look at Lucy Hale’s Converse sneakers. CREDIT: Rex/Shutterstock For footwear, Hale selected all-white Converse Chuck Taylor All-Star sneakers. The kicks were released initially in 1917 as the first basketball shoe, but have since become a go-to lifestyle silhouette. The sneakers feature a white rubber sole and toe cap, with a canvas upper.
